Crow's Type I and Type II schizophrenia are characterized by:

a. Positive symptoms and negative symptoms, respectively
b. Early onset and late onset, respectively
c. Genetic-basis and environmental-basis, respectively
d. Institutionalized and non-institutionalized, respectively


A
